New Delhi, Nov. 10: An explosion occurred near Delhi’s Red Fort Metro Station on Monday, damaging some vehicles.
The blast occurred in a car near Gate Number 1 of the Metro station, after which three to four other vehicles also caught fire and sustained damage. One person has been confirmed to have died in the explosion.
“A call was received regarding an explosion in a car near Gate No. 1 of the Red Fort Metro Station, after which three to four vehicles also caught fire and sustained damage,” the Delhi fire department (DFS) said in a statement.
According to the latest information, seven fire tenders have been dispatched to the location after the call was received at 7:05 PM.
The authorities have sounded a high alert in Delhi after the explosion.
This comes on a day when Jammu and Kashmir police, in coordination with other agencies, busted a terror module involving the Jaish-e-Mohammed and Ansar Ghazwat-ul-Hind and spanning Kashmir, Haryana and Uttar Pradesh.
Eight people, including three doctors, were arrested after the terror module was busted in Faridabad.
